◆ Coconut oil
A study published in The American Journal of Clinical Nutrition found that people who consumed coconut oil lost weight and fat faster than those who ate olive oil.
The medium chain fat in coconut oil is quickly absorbed and delivered to the liver directly, without time for fat to accumulate in the body, which is converted into energy. It also promotes metabolism in this process, helping to control weight.
◆ Egg
Rich in choline, one of the vitamin B complexes. Choline is an essential nutrient for the body's cell membranes. Two eggs contain more than half of the daily need for these nutrients.
Lack of choline affects the genes that accumulate belly fat. Studies have shown that people who eat eggs lose weight more easily than those who eat foods high in carbohydrates in the morning.
◆ Apples eaten in peel
One medium-sized apple contains 100 calories and contains 4.5g of fiber. According to the study, increasing the daily intake of fiber 10g can reduce visceral fat by 3.7%.
In particular, those who ate apples peeled with exercise decreased visceral fat by 7.4%. Apples are one of the most nutritious fruits in the skin, such as antioxidants.
◆ Cinnamon
Adding to other foods has the effect of enhancing nutrition. Studies have shown that the antioxidant content of cinnamon, polyphenols, improves insulin sensitivity and thus improves our body's ability to store fat and regulate hunger. In addition, adding cinnamon to foods high in carbohydrates stabilizes blood sugar and prevents insulin from rising rapidly.
◆ Avocado
Guacamole, a Mexican dish made by mixing onion, tomato, and pepper with mashed avocado, is considered as an effective healthy food to eliminate hunger. Studies have shown that people who ate a half of avocado at lunch had 40% less food.
◆ Lettuce
It is well known that leafy vegetables such as kale and spinach are good for health. Double lettuce is also included. Studies have shown that eating less than 3 grams of monounsaturated fat, such as olive oil, helps to consume carotenoids from vegetables. Carotenoids are known to help prevent chronic diseases such as cancer and heart disease.
